13 months ago I did one shot lupron, then external beam, then brachy. I was 60 yrs old with localized cancer with 6,6 ,3-4, 3-4, 4-3 Gleasons and a PSA 8.58, and a large large prostate (37), BMI:37.8 and existing heredtry lymphadema(legs)

.

13 months later, my PSA is less than one (.19), my testosterone is in the low normal range, and "only" side effects are erectile issues and orgasm issues (id don't happen), and urinary difficulties which are totally taken care of by flomax at night. UNTIL two weeks ago. Suddenly, I am having constipation issues, and difficulty "going" when I do, and am also now urinating every two and a half hours like clockwork....

Is this a delayed side effect from the radiation? A change in reaction to medication? A sign that things are not as good as appear (next blood draw is 25 days away), or another issue unrelated to the cancer adventure? Any thoughts, insight or info is appreciated.

"Late term" side effects do happen. After brachy boost therapy, late term urinary side effects can occur, but late term GI side effects are rare. Your constipation probably is not from that.

You can take up to 2 Flomax/ day. I found one Rapaflo worked better than 2 Flomax. Hopefully, it will be transient.

I am about 3 years post treatment. Dx was Gleason 8, stage 4 (One suspected met to a femur) I had 37 RT sessions, LD Brachtherapy, and a10 session RT followup focussed on pelvic lymph nodes. Stopped Lupron and Casodex 18 months after treatment, but I've stayed on Avodart and Flomax since then. I had severely painful urinary issues beginning several weeks after treatment, lasting for 3-4 weeks, which gradually resolved. I'm pretty sure that due to the brachytherapy. PSA is still at around 0.01, pretty close to the limit of detectability. T increased to low normal the first 2 years, but now is actually below the low end of range. I'm again experiencing much fatigue, made worse by low thyroid, but I won't get TRT until research indicates that it's safe for my situation. Exercise helps.
